The Mahindra Thar Roxx is expected to receive its first meaningful update soon, building on the momentum of Mahindra’s 5-door Thar lineup. While the company has not officially detailed the changes, industry
inputs and several recent spy shots point to a round of refinements rather than a ground-up overhaul. The focus is likely to be on improving everyday usability, compliance updates, and feature additions, while retaining the Thar Roxx’s core off-road positioning. Here’s a clear look at what buyers can realistically expect from the upcoming update.

Mahindra Thar Roxx Facelift: Expected Design Updates
The 2026 Thar Roxx is likely to carry forward its upright, boxy silhouette and short overhangs that define its off-road character. Visual changes, if any, are expected to be subtle. These could include revised grille detailing, updated alloy wheel designs, as well as refreshed colour options. Mahindra is unlikely to alter the overall body structure, as the current design already aligns well with the lifestyle SUV segment.
Mahindra Thar Roxx Facelift: Interior And Cabin Improvements
Inside, Mahindra may focus on improving cabin quality and usability. Expect updated upholstery materials, revised trims, and possibly small layout tweaks to improve ergonomics. Feature additions could include an upgraded touchscreen interface, improved connected car tech, and better rear-seat comfort.
Mahindra Thar Roxx Facelift: Powertrain Expectations
Engine options are expected to remain familiar, with petrol and diesel powertrains continuing in the lineup. However, updates to improve refinement, drivability, and emissions compliance are likely. Mahindra may also recalibrate existing engines to deliver better low-speed performance, which is important for both city use and off-road conditions.
Mahindra Thar Roxx Facelift: Ride, Handling And Off-Road Hardware
The Thar Roxx’s ladder-frame platform and off-road hardware are expected to remain unchanged. Features such as four-wheel drive, high ground clearance, and terrain-focused suspension tuning should continue. Mahindra may fine-tune suspension settings to balance ride comfort and off-road capability, especially given the Roxx’s longer wheelbase compared to the 3-door Thar.
Mahindra Thar Roxx Facelift: Safety And Technology
Safety is expected to be a key focus area for the 2026 update. Additional airbags, enhanced electronic stability control calibration, and possibly advanced driver assistance features could be introduced to meet evolving regulations and buyer expectations. These updates would help the Thar Roxx stay competitive against newer lifestyle SUVs.

Mahindra Thar Roxx Facelift: Positioning And Launch Timeline
The 2026 Mahindra Thar Roxx will sit above the standard 3-door Thar, targeting buyers who want off-road capability with improved practicality. A launch sometime in 2026 appears likely, with pricing expected to see a marginal revision reflecting feature and compliance updates.
